Cranberry Wild Rice Pilaf

Delicious, stick-to-your-ribs hotdish/casserole made with nutty wild rice, hearty barley, and fruity craisins. Seasoned with sage and marjoram, it’s perfect anytime of the year, but it’s especially wonderful at Thanksgiving.

  • Makes 5 cups

  • Ready in 65 minutes

  • Instructions: Stir wild rice into 3-½ cups boiling water. Simmer 10 minutes, then add remaining package ingredients. Cover and bake in a 350-degree oven for 60 minutes. 

  • Optional: add cooked turkey or ground beef.

  • I always make this on the Saturday after Thanksgiving, when all the gravy is gone. I stir all the little, leftover pieces of turkey into the mix and bake.

Nutrition Facts: *The % Daily Value (DV) tells you how much a nutrient in a serving of food contributes to a daily diet. 2,000 calories a day is recommended for general nutrition advice.

Serving size 1/3 cup dry mix,. Servings per container 5, Calories 150, Total Fat 1g (1%), Sat. Fat 0g (0%), Transfat 0g (0%), Cholesterol 0mg (0%), Sodium, 27mg (1%), Total Carbohydrates 28g (10%), Dietary Fiber 1g (3.5%), Total Sugars 2g, Added Sugar 0g (0%), Protein 4g, Vitamin D 0mcg )(0%), Calcium 24mg (2%), Iron 2.5mg (14%), Potassium 178mg (4.5%).

Ingredients
Cultivated wild rice, barley, raisins (cranberries, sugar, sunflower oil), onion, celery, broth (maltodextrin, salt, autolyzed yeast extract,  natural flavor, onion, celery, parsley, spinach, garlic, carrot, potato flour, xanthan gum, spices, extractive of spices (including turmeric), soy lecithin, soy oil), spices. Contains SOY
